Kumhar Population - Latehar, Jharkhand

Kumhar is a small village located in Latehar Block of Latehar district, Jharkhand with total 32 families residing. The Kumhar village has population of 167 of which 82 are males while 85 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Kumhar village population of children with age 0-6 is 20 which makes up 11.98 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kumhar village is 1037 which is higher than Jharkhand state average of 948. Child Sex Ratio for the Kumhar as per census is 538, lower than Jharkhand average of 948.

Kumhar village has lower literacy rate compared to Jharkh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Kumhar village was 49.66 % compared to 66.41 % of Jharkhand. In Kumhar Male literacy stands at 62.32 % while female literacy rate was 38.46 %.

Caste Factor

In Kumhar village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 59.28 % of total population in Kumhar village. There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) in Kumhar village of Latehar.

Work Profile

In Kumhar village out of total population, 131 were engaged in work activities. 6.87 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 93.13 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 131 workers engaged in Main Work, 3 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
